Modern Kitchen Renovation Trends for 2023
Kitchen renovations are always popular, but this year, there's a slew of fresh and exciting trends emerging. From bold color choices to innovative materials, homeowners are seeking new ways to personalize their kitchens. Here are ten top kitchen renovation trends that are sure to inspire your next remodel:
- Integrated Appliances: Convenience is key with smart appliances that can be operated remotely and adjust to your cooking habits.
- Green Materials: Reclaimed wood, bamboo, and recycled glass are trending upwards for countertops, cabinetry, and backsplashes.
- Contrasting Color Schemes: Don't be afraid to combine colors! Dark cabinets with light countertops or vibrant accent walls add a touch of personality.
- Open Shelving: Embrace open shelving to highlight your kitchenware. It creates a light feel.
- Floating Islands: These islands are multi-functional, providing additional counter space and seating.
- Eye-Catching Fixtures: Upgrade your lighting with dramatic pendants that set the mood.
- Brass Hardware: Incorporate metallic finishes like brass or copper to add a touch of sophistication.
- Mosaic Tile: Get creative with your backsplash! Geometric patterns, mosaic tiles, or textured surfaces make a memorable design.
- Apron-Front Sinks: Make a practical upgrade with a deep sink and a contemporary spout.
- Custom Cabinetry: Maximize your kitchen's functionality with customized cabinets, built-in pantry systems, or pull-out drawers for optimal storage.

Planning a Functional and Beautiful IKEA Kitchen Layout
Ready to transform your kitchen with the help of IKEA's versatile selections? A well-designed IKEA kitchen combines both functionality and style, making it a joyful ikea kitchen space to cook and gather. First, consider your needs and preferences. Do you favor ample storage? A large countertop? Consider the layout of your space, including doors and existing appliances.
- Draw a rough layout on paper, calculating the dimensions of your kitchen and potential furniture arrangements.
- Explore IKEA's website or store for cabinets, countertops, sinks, and other elements. Consider different styles to complement your existing decor.
- Utilize IKEA's online configurator tools to preview your kitchen in 3D. This can help you fine-tune your layout and selections before making any investments.
Remember to factor the location of electrical outlets, plumbing lines, and ventilation systems when designing your layout. Seek advice from a professional if you need support with complex installations or have any concerns.
